Ticket: Studio B fit-out complete. The recording studio on level 3 of the Quillmere Annex is now available for training-video sessions booked through the Roomly calendar. Reception staff should direct presenters to the freight lift, as the main lift does not stop on 3 after 18:00. Equipment stays in the studio; nothing leaves without a sign-out slip. The studio door keypad has been reprogrammed, and the current entry code is given below.

door code, tahop-fahap: bdg-JZCXMY-37375484

Team,

As discussed in last week's sync, responsibility for investigating the garbage-collection pauses in the Pairline matching service is moving off the platform rotation. The pauses (p99 spikes near 800ms during evening batch windows) correlate with large candidate-set allocations, and we believe tuning the generational thresholds will need sustained focus rather than rotating attention. All related incidents, tuning experiments, and dashboard changes should now be routed to a single owner. Effective Monday, that person is named below.

account owner for fajep-yagef: Kasix Eliiel

## Deployment — Farebright Rules Engine. Deploys go through the sealed pipeline only; no manual pushes. Rule bundles are signed at build time and verified on load; unsigned bundles are rejected. Secrets come from the vault sidecar, never from files in the image. Rollback swaps the bundle pointer, nothing else. The engine boots with the configuration values below.

config for kafof-bawef:
holath:
  log_level: debug
  metrics_host: metrics.holath.qorvelsys.internal
  pin: 2191
  pool_size: 32